Key Responsibilities
As an ICT Tutor, you will be responsible for:
- Managing Wide Area Networks (WAN) and Local Area Networks (LAN): Oversee the setup, configuration, and maintenance of WAN and LAN networks at the central office or campus. Ensure network stability and efficiency to support educational activities.
- Managing and Maintaining Servers: Regularly monitor server performance, perform routine maintenance, and ensure the security of server data. Address any server issues promptly to minimize downtime.
- Providing User Support and Resolving End-User Problems: Assist students, faculty, and staff with technical issues related to ICT. Provide timely solutions and support to enhance user experience.
- Managing Day-to-Day Backups of the System: Implement and oversee regular backup procedures to ensure data integrity and availability. Restore data as needed and maintain accurate backup records.
- Installing and Maintaining System and Application Software: Ensure all ICT systems and applications are up-to-date and running smoothly. Perform software installations, updates, and troubleshooting as required.
- Conducting Training Sessions for Students and Staff: Organize and lead training sessions to educate students and staff on using ICT resources effectively. Provide guidance on best practices and new technologies.
- Developing and Updating ICT Documentation: Create and maintain comprehensive documentation for ICT procedures, network configurations, and user guides. Ensure documentation is accessible and up-to-date.
- Ensuring Network Security: Implement and enforce security measures to protect the network from unauthorized access, malware, and other threats. Regularly review and update security protocols.
- Monitoring and Reporting on ICT Infrastructure: Regularly assess the performance of ICT infrastructure and report on its status. Provide recommendations for improvements and upgrades to enhance efficiency and effectiveness.
- Participating in ICT Projects: Contribute to the planning, execution, and management of ICT projects aimed at improving the college’s technological capabilities. Collaborate with team members to achieve project goals.
- Supporting Online Learning Platforms: Assist in the setup and maintenance of online learning platforms used by the college. Ensure that these platforms are user-friendly and accessible to all students and staff.
- Troubleshooting Hardware Issues: Diagnose and resolve hardware problems with computers, printers, and other ICT equipment. Perform repairs or coordinate with external vendors for repairs when necessary.
